
ওয়ার্ডপ্রেস হলো জনপ্রিয় একটি সিএমএস। যার মাধ্যমে কোডিং জ্ঞান ছাড়া ওয়েবসাইট তৈরি করতে পারবেন। CMS অর্থাৎ Content Management System বা কনটেন্ট ম্যানেজমেন্ট সিস্টেম। এটি এমন একটি সফটওয়্যার যা আপনাকে কোনো প্রযুক্তিগত জ্ঞান ছাড়াই একটি ওয়েবসাইট তৈরি, পরিচালনা এবং আপডেট করতে সাহায্য করে। আপনি যদি কোনো ওয়েবসাইট তৈরি করতে চান, তাহলে আপনাকে অবশ্যই একটি CMS বেছে নিতে হবে।
ওয়ার্ডপ্রেস কী?
WordPress হল একটি ওপেন সোর্স কন্টেন্ট ম্যানেজমেন্ট সিস্টেম (CMS)। যা আপনাকে সহজেই ওয়েবসাইট তৈরি ও পরিচালনা করতে সাহায্য করে। এটি PHP ও MySQL ভিত্তিক এবং পৃথিবীর ৪৩% ওয়েবসাইট এখন ওয়ার্ডপ্রেস ব্যবহার করছে। সারা পৃথিবীতে জনপ্রিয় এই সিএমস দিয়ে বিশ্বের অনেক বড় বড় কোম্পানির ওয়েবসাইট তৈরি হয়েছে।
কেন ওয়ার্ডপ্রেস জনপ্রিয়?
ওয়ার্ডপ্রেসের জনপ্রিয়তার মূল কারণ এর ব্যবহার সহজ, ফ্লেক্সিবিলিটি এবং বিভিন্ন ধরনের প্লাগিন ও থিমের সুবিশাল লাইব্রেরি। এটি আপনার সাইটকে সহজেই কাস্টমাইজ করার বিভিন্ন টুলস দিবে। যার মাধ্যমে আপনি খুব ইজিলি একটি ওয়েবসাইট তৈরি করতে পারবেন। ওয়ার্ডপ্রেস সবার কাছে জনপ্রিয় হওয়ার অন্যতম আরেকটি কারণ হলো এর থিম, প্লাগিন সব কিছু রেডিমেট পাওয়া যায়।
ওয়ার্ডপ্রেসের বিভিন্ন সমস্যা
ওয়ার্ডপ্রেস থিমের সমস্যা
ওয়ার্ডপ্রেস ওয়েবসাইটের স্ট্রাকচার নির্ভর করে একটি থিমের উপরে। যদিও তিন ব্যতীত কাস্টমাইজ ডিজাইন করা সম্ভব। তবে অধিকাংশ ব্যবহারকারী থিম ব্যবহার করতে অভ্যস্ত। কিন্তু প্রায় সময় থিমের বিভিন্ন সমস্যা দেখা দেয়।
থিম ইনস্টলেশন সমস্যা
অনেক সময় থিম ইনস্টল করার সময় “stylesheet missing” বা “broken theme” এর মতো সমস্যা দেখা দিতে পারে। অনেকেই আমরা অনলাইন থেকে ক্র্যাক ভার্সন থিম ব্যবহার করে থাকি। বিশেষ করে সে সকল থিমগুলো ম্যালোয়ার যুক্ত থাকে। যার ফলে অনেক ফাইল মিসিং হয়। থিম গুলো ভাইরাসে যুক্ত থাকায় ইন্সটল করার ক্ষেত্রে বিভিন্ন সমস্যা দেখা দিতে পারে।
থিম আপডেট সমস্যা
আপডেট করার পর সাইট ব্রেক হওয়া বা কম্প্যাটিবিলিটি ইস্যু দেখা দিতে পারে। একটি থিম আপডেট করার পূর্বে ব্যাকআপ রাখা জরুরী। কারণ যেকোনো টেকনিকেল সমস্যার কারণে একটি থিম আপডেট করার ফলে আপনার ওয়েবসাইটটি ইরোর হয়ে যেতে পারে। বিভিন্ন সময় থিমের মালিক বা কোম্পানি উক্ত থিমের বিভিন্ন ফিচার উন্নত করে থাকেন। যার ফলে ব্যবহারকারীকে থিম আপডেট করতে বলা হয়।
ওয়েবসাইটের স্পিড অপটিমাইজ : ওয়ার্ডপ্রেস সাইট সুপার ফাস্ট করুন
থিম কম্প্যাটিবিলিটি সমস্যা
নতুন থিম ইনস্টল করার পর পুরানো প্লাগিনের সাথে কম্প্যাটিবিলিটি সমস্যা হতে পারে। প্রায় থিম কম্প্যাটিবিলিটি সমস্যা দেখা দেয় যার প্রধান কারণ হতে পারে আপনার ওয়েবসাইটে ইন্সটল থাকা প্লাগিনগুলো। পুরনো ভার্সনের কোন প্লাগিন ব্যবহার করলে সেটি থিমের সাথে সামঞ্জস্যপূর্ণ না হলে আপনার ওয়েবসাইট ইরোর হতে পারে।
থিম কাস্টমাইজেশন সমস্যা
কাস্টমাইজ করতে গেলে কোডিং জানতে হয়, যা সব ব্যবহারকারীর জন্য সহজ নয়। অনেকেই আমরা ফ্রি থিম ব্যবহার করে থাকি যেখানে একটি ওয়েবসাইট কাস্টমাইজেশন এর জন্য পর্যাপ্ত টুলস দেয়া থাকে না। সেক্ষেত্রে থিম কাস্টমাইজেশন এর সমস্যা হতে পারে। তাই থিম কাস্টমাইজেশন করার জন্য আপনাকে কোডিং জানা জরুরী।
ওয়ার্ডপ্রেস থিম সমস্যা সমাধান
সঠিকভাবে থিম ইনস্টলেশন
থিম ইনস্টল করার আগে থিমের ডকুমেন্টেশন ভালোভাবে পড়ে নিন এবং ডিরেক্টরি স্ট্রাকচার চেক করুন। প্রায় সময় থিমের ফাইল মিসিং হয়। যার প্রধান একটি কারণ হতে পারে নাল বা ক্রাক থিম ব্যবহার করা। তাই অবশ্যই ওয়ার্ডপ্রেস লাইব্রেরি থেকে ফ্রি থিম অথবা পেইড থিম ব্যবহার করুন।
Theme আপডেট করা
থিম আপডটে করা অন্তত্য জরুরী। কারণ বিভিন্ন সময় থিমের অনেক সিকুয়েরিটি ইস্যু থাকে। যা আপডেট করার মাধ্যমে ডেভলোপার সমাধান করে থাকেন। আপডেট করার আগে সাইটের পুরো ব্যাকআপ নিয়ে নিন। এছাড়া, থিম ডেভেলপারের রিলিজ নোট পড়ে নিন।
কম্প্যাটিবিলিটি ঠিক করা
কম্প্যাটিবিলিটি সমস্যা হলে থিমের কোড কাস্টমাইজ করার চেয়ে কম্প্যাটিবল প্লাগিন ব্যবহার করা ভাল। মাঝে মধ্যে থিম এবং আপনার সাইটের পিএইচপি ভার্সন অমিলের কারণে ওয়েবসাইট ইরর হতে পারে। তাই PHP ভার্সন আপডেট করার মাধ্যমেও ঠিক করে নিতে পারেন।
কাস্টমাইজেশন সহজ করা
ওয়ার্ডপ্রেস থিম কাস্টমাইজেশন করার জন্য আমরা মূল থিমকে বেছে নেই। তাতে ওয়েবসাইটের লোডিং বেড়ে যায় এবং সময় সাপেক্ষ। সুতরাং থিম কাস্টমাইজ করার জন্য Child Theme ব্যবহার করতে পারেন। এটি মূল থিমের কোন পরিবর্তন ছাড়াই কাস্টমাইজেশন সহজ করে।
ওয়ার্ডপ্রেস প্লাগিনের সমস্যা
প্লাগিন ইনস্টলেশন সমস্যা
Plugin ইনস্টল করার সময় “plugin installation failed” বা “plugin not compatible” এর মতো সমস্যা দেখা দিতে পারে।
প্রশ্ন যুক্ত করে টাকা ইনকাম করুন
প্লাগিন আপডেট সমস্যা
আপডেট করার পর প্লাগিন কাজ না করা বা সাইট ব্রেক হওয়া সাধারণ সমস্যা। আপনার ওয়েবসাইট ডকুমেন্টগুলো উক্ত প্লাগিন এর সাথে ম্যাচ না করলে আপডেটের কারণে ইরর আসতে পারে।
প্লাগিন কম্প্যাটিবিলিটি সমস্যা
নতুন প্লাগিন ইনস্টল করার পর অন্যান্য প্লাগিনের সাথে কম্প্যাটিবিলিটি সমস্যা হতে পারে। বিশেষ করে একই ফিচার সমৃদ্ধ দুটি প্লাগিন ইনস্টল করলে এই সমস্যা হতে পারে।
প্লাগিন কনফিগারেশন সমস্যা
কনফিগারেশন ঠিকমতো না করার কারণে প্লাগিন ঠিকমতো কাজ না করতে পারে। আপনি যখন একটি প্লাগিন ইন্সটল করবেন তখন অবশ্যই তার সেটিংস থেকে সবকিছু ঠিকঠাকমতো সেট করে নিতে হবে।
ওয়ার্ডপ্রেস প্লাগিন সমস্যা সমাধান
সঠিকভাবে প্লাগিন ইনস্টলেশন
প্লাগিন ইনস্টল করার আগে প্লাগিনের রিভিউ ও রেটিং চেক করুন এবং ডকুমেন্টেশন পড়ে নিন।
প্লাগিন আপডেট করা
আপডেট করার আগে সাইটের পুরো ব্যাকআপ নিয়ে নিন। নতুন ভার্সনের চেঞ্জলগ পড়ে নিন। অবশ্যই দেখে নিবেন প্লাগিনের নতুন আপডেটে কি কি পরিবর্তন আনা হয়েছে।
কম্প্যাটিবিলিটি ঠিক করা
কম্প্যাটিবিলিটি সমস্যা হলে প্লাগিনের সাপোর্ট টিমের সাথে যোগাযোগ করুন এবং প্রয়োজনীয় আপডেট নিন।
কনফিগারেশন সহজ করা
প্লাগিন কনফিগারেশনের জন্য ডকুমেন্টেশন ফলো করুন এবং প্রয়োজন হলে ডেভেলপারের সাহায্য নিন।
নিরাপত্তা সমস্যা ও সমাধান
সিকিউরিটি প্লাগিন ব্যবহার
Wordfence, Sucuri, All in One প্রভৃতি সিকিউরিটি প্লাগিন ব্যবহার করুন সাইটের নিরাপত্তার জন্য।
সাইট ব্যাকআপ রাখা
বিভিন্ন হোস্টিং প্রভাইডার অটো ব্যাকআপ রাখে। তাদের ব্যাকআপ না থাকলেও আপনি নিজে সাইটের নিয়মিত ব্যাকআপ রাখুন। রেগুলার ব্যাকআপ নেওয়ার জন্য UpdraftPlus বা BackWPup প্লাগিন ব্যবহার করুন। বিভিন্ন সময়ে ওয়েবসাইট Error হয়ে যায়। যার ফলে আমরা আমাদের ওয়েবসাইটের গুরুত্বপূর্ণ তথ্য হারিয়ে ফেলতে পারি। তাই অবশ্যই প্রতিনিয়ত ওয়েবসাইটের ব্যাকআপ রাখা জরুরী।
ওয়েবসাইটের স্পিড অপটিমাইজ : ওয়ার্ডপ্রেস সাইট সুপার ফাস্ট করুন
নিয়মিত আপডেট করা
ওয়ার্ডপ্রেস, থিম ও প্লাগিন নিয়মিত আপডেট করুন নিরাপত্তা রক্ষার জন্য। আপনার ওয়েবসাইট থিম এবং প্লাগিন আপডেট রাখার চেষ্টা করুন। অন্যথায় যেকোনো সিকিউরিটি ইস্যুর কারণে সাইট ভাইরাস অথবা হ্যাকিংয়ের শিকার হতে পারে।
পারফরমেন্স সমস্যা ও সমাধান
সাইট স্পিড অপটিমাইজেশন
সাইট স্পিড অপটিমাইজ করার জন্য W3 Total Cache বা WP Super Cache প্লাগিন ব্যবহার করুন। এই প্লাগিন আপনার ওয়েবসাইটের বিভিন্ন সমস্যার সমাধান দিবে এবং ওয়েবসাইটের পরিত্যাক্ত ফাইল ডিলেট করে সাইটকে ফ্রেস ও গতি সম্পন্ন রাখবে।
ইমেজ কম্প্রেশন
ইমেজ সােইজ বেশি হলে ওয়েবসাইট লোডিং বেড়ে যায়। তাই ইমেজ কম্প্রেশনের জন্য Smush বা EWWW Image Optimizer প্লাগিন ব্যবহার করুন।
ক্যাশিং প্লাগিন ব্যবহার
ক্যাশিং প্লাগিন যেমন W3 Total Cache ব্যবহার করলে সাইটের লোড টাইম কমে যাবে।
ওয়ার্ডপ্রেস সাইটের সার্বিক রক্ষণাবেক্ষণ
সাইট মনিটরিং
সাইট মনিটর করার জন্য Google Analytics এবং Google Search Console ব্যবহার করুন।
ডিবাগিং
সাইটের সমস্যা সমাধানের জন্য WP Debugging প্লাগিন ব্যবহার করুন। প্লাগিন ব্যতীত সি প্যানেল থেকে ডিবাগ মুড ট্রু করে দিতে পারেন। তাহলে ওয়েবসাইটের কোন সমস্যা হলে সেটি হোম পেজে ভিজিট করলে দেখতে পাবেন।
উপসংহার
ওয়ার্ডপ্রেস থিম ও প্লাগিনের বিভিন্ন সমস্যা সমাধান করার জন্য উপযুক্ত ব্যবস্থা গ্রহণ করলে সাইটের পারফরমেন্স ও নিরাপত্তা বজায় রাখা সম্ভব। নিয়মিত রক্ষণাবেক্ষণ ও আপডেট করলে আপনার সাইট সবসময় সেরা অবস্থায় থাকবে।
FAQs
ওয়ার্ডপ্রেস থিম কাস্টমাইজেশন সহজ করার উপায় কী?
থিম কাস্টমাইজেশন সহজ করার জন্য Child Theme ব্যবহার করতে পারেন।
কোন সিকিউরিটি প্লাগিন সেরা?
Wordfence এবং Sucuri হল জনপ্রিয় এবং কার্যকর সিকিউরিটি প্লাগিন।
ক্যাশিং প্লাগিন কেন ব্যবহার করা উচিত?
ক্যাশিং প্লাগিন সাইটের লোড টাইম কমায় এবং পারফরমেন্স বাড়ায়।
প্লাগিন আপডেটের আগে কী করতে হবে?
আপডেটের আগে সাইটের পুরো ব্যাকআপ নেওয়া উচিত।
ওয়ার্ডপ্রেস সাইট মনিটরিংয়ের জন্য কোন টুল ব্যবহার করা যায়?
Google Analytics এবং Google Search Console সাইট মনিটর করার জন্য সেরা টুল।